Simplify by using the distributive property 5 ( 2x - 5 )
drek231 [11]
Hello!

The problem has asked that we simplify the given expression using the Distributive Property. The Distributive Property states the following:

a(b + c) = ab + ac
a(b – c) = ab – ac

In this case, we’ll use the second of the two formulas listed above. Let’s begin by inserting any known values given in the original problem:

a(b – c) = ab – ac
5(2x – 5) = 5(2x) – 5(5)

Now simplify the right side of the equation:

5(2x) – 5(5) = 10x – 25

We have now proven that 5(2x – 5) is equal to 10x – 25. Therefore, the correct answer is C.

What is the slope of the line that passes through the points (14, 5) and (20, –4)? A. -3/2 B. -2/3 C. 2/3 D. 3/2
Lynna [10]
The slope of the line that passes through the points (14/5) and (20, -4), so you take y-y/x-x so you substitute the y's in for 5 and -4 and x in for 14 and 20.

5--4/ 14-20
9/-6
Then you make the fraction smaller! 
-3/2 = Answer <span />
